Progress. It all comes flooding back to me now! You must set
OPENBLAS_NUM_THREADS before launching Octave, which is of course a
real pain and cannot surely be justified as you might actually want to
change the number of threads used. I Imagine the DLL is loaded at
Octave startup and the value of OPENBLAS_NUM_THREADS is read at that
time.

If you don't set OPENBLAS_NUM_THREADS the default is to use enough
threads to consume most the CPU fully, and on my system I get

  >> tic; a=rand(10000); b=a*a;toc
  Elapsed time is 13.0891 seconds.

setting OPENBLAS_NUM_THREADS=1 and then calling Octave:
   >> tic; a=rand(10000); b=a*a;toc
   Elapsed time is 42.447 seconds.

One way to set OPENBLAS_NUM_THREADS which avoid leaving the Octave
environment is:

  >> setenv('OPENBLAS_NUM_THREADS','1')
  >> system C:/Octave/Octave-5.2.0/octave.vbs

This launches a second copy of Octave with the first as parent hence
inheriting the environment variables.
